Java Developer – CRM Backend / Integration The Developer – CRM Backend Integration is responsible for designing, building, and maintaining backend components that support the CRM platform. The role focuses on microservices development, system integration, APIs, and event‐driven architectures, contributing directly to squad‐based Agile delivery. The developer works closely with other CRM squad members (Developers, Testers, Product Owner) to deliver high‐quality, reliable CRM services and integrations.ResponsabilitiesDesign, develop, and enhance CRM backend services, including microservices and APIs.Implement and maintain RESTful APIs and integration components to support CRM features and external systems.Contribute to event‐driven integrations, including messaging‐based communication using Kafka or similar messaging platforms.Participate actively in Agile/Scrum ceremonies, sprint planning, and sprint delivery within the CRM squads.Resolve defects, support troubleshooting activities, and contribute to improving performance, reliability, and scalability of CRM services.Apply good engineering practices such as unit testing, code reviews, and CI/CD integration.Collaborate with QA and Product Owner roles to ensure features meet functional and integration requirements.RequirementsStrong experience with Java and Spring Boot for backend development.Solid understanding of REST APIs and backend integration patterns.Experience with microservices architectures and service‐to‐service communication.Familiarity with messaging platforms such as Kafka or MQ.Knowledge of CI/CD pipelines, Git‐based version control, and automated builds.Experience with unit testing and backend test automation practices.Basic understanding of logging, monitoring, and observability for backend services.English is mandatory.Nice to havePrevious experience working on CRM platforms or large enterprise backend systems.Exposure to cloud‐based environments and distributed systems.Experience working in multi‐squad or scaled Agile setups.What You'll Love About Working HereJoin a multicultural and inclusive team environment.Enjoy a supportive atmosphere promoting work life balance.Hybrid work.Your career growth is central to our mission. Our array of career growth programs and diverse professionals are crafted to support you in exploring a world of opportunities.Access valuable training and certifications in cutting‐edge technologies.Engage in exciting projects.Health and life insurance.Referral program with bonuses for talent recommendations.Great office locations.#J-18808-Ljbffr